الملخص EN

Background.

Joint hypermobility syndrome/Ehlers-Danlos syndrome, hypermobility type (JHS/EDS-HT), is a hereditary connective tissue disorder mainly characterized by generalized joint hypermobility, skin texture abnormalities, and visceral and vascular dysfunctions, also comprising symptoms of autonomic dysfunction.

This study aims to further evaluate cardiovascular autonomic involvement in JHS/EDS-HT by a battery of functional tests.

Methods.

The response to cardiovascular reflex tests comprising deep breathing, Valsalva maneuver, 30/15 ratio, handgrip test, and head-up tilt test was studied in 35 JHS/EDS-HT adults.

Heart rate and blood pressure variability was also investigated by spectral analysis in comparison to age and sex healthy matched group.

Results.

Valsalva ratio was normal in all patients, but 37.2% of them were not able to finish the test.

At tilt, 48.6% patients showed postural orthostatic tachycardia, 31.4% orthostatic intolerance, 20% normal results.

Only one patient had orthostatic hypotension.

Spectral analysis showed significant higher baroreflex sensitivity values at rest compared to controls.

Conclusions.

This study confirms the abnormal cardiovascular autonomic profile in adults with JHS/EDS-HT and found the higher baroreflex sensitivity as a potential disease marker and clue for future research.
